Preguntas etiquetadas con ajax

AJAX (JavaScript asíncrono y XML) es una técnica para crear interfaces de usuario interactivas del sitio web sin la actualización o recarga tradicional de la página web. Utiliza el intercambio de datos asíncrono entre el cliente y el servidor para actualizar la información mostrada y responder a las interacciones del usuario sin problemas. Incluya etiquetas adicionales para lenguajes de programación, bibliotecas, marcos, navegador web, protocolos y otra información ambiental.


2
¿Error de CORS en el mismo dominio?
Me estoy encontrando con un extraño problema de CORS en este momento. Aquí está el mensaje de error: XMLHttpRequest cannot load http://localhost:8666/routeREST/select?q=[...] Origin http://localhost:8080 is not allowed by Access-Control-Allow-Origin Dos servidores: localhost: 8666 / routeREST /: este es un servidor de botella de Python simple. localhost: 8080 /: Python simpleHTTPserver …

7
Rails 3: ¿Cómo "redirect_to" en una llamada Ajax?
El siguiente attempt_loginmétodo se llama usando Ajax después de que se envía un formulario de inicio de sesión. class AccessController < ApplicationController [...] def attempt_login authorized_user = User.authenticate(params[:username], params[:password]) if authorized_user session[:user_id] = authorized_user.id session[:username] = authorized_user.username flash[:notice] = "Hello #{authorized_user.name}." redirect_to(:controller => 'jobs', :action => 'index') else [...] end …

22
Solicitud de Spring JSON obteniendo 406 (no aceptable)
este es mi javascript: function getWeather() { $.getJSON('getTemperature/' + $('.data option:selected').val(), null, function(data) { alert('Success'); }); } este es mi controlador: @RequestMapping(value="/getTemperature/{id}", headers="Accept=*/*", method = RequestMethod.GET) @ResponseBody public Weather getTemparature(@PathVariable("id") Integer id){ Weather weather = weatherService.getCurrentWeather(id); return weather; } spring-servlet.xml <context:annotation-config /> <tx:annotation-driven /> Recibiendo este error: GET http://localhost:8080/web/getTemperature/2 406 …
85 java  javascript  ajax  json  spring 




6
¿Hay algún análogo a un 'finalmente' en las llamadas jQuery AJAX?
¿Existe un análogo de Java 'finalmente' en las llamadas jQuery AJAX? Tengo este código aquí. En mi siempre arrojo una excepción, sin embargo SIEMPRE quiero que vaya al método then () . call.xmlHttpReq = $.ajax({ url : url, dataType : 'json', type : 'GET' }).always(function(processedDataOrXHRWrapper, textStatus, xhrWrapperOrErrorThrown) { throw "something"; …

7
AJAX: ¿Compruebe si una cadena es JSON?
Mi JavaScript a veces falla en esta línea: var json = eval('(' + this.responseText + ')'); Los bloqueos se producen cuando el argumento de eval()no es JSON. ¿Hay alguna forma de verificar si la cadena es JSON antes de realizar esta llamada? No quiero usar un marco, ¿hay alguna forma …

12
La llamada jQuery .load () no ejecuta JavaScript en el archivo HTML cargado
Este parece ser un problema relacionado únicamente con Safari. Probé 4 en Mac y 3 en Windows y todavía no tengo suerte. Estoy intentando cargar un archivo HTML externo y ejecutar el JavaScript que está incrustado. El código que estoy tratando de usar es este: $("#myBtn").click(function() { $("#myDiv").load("trackingCode.html"); }); trackingCode.html …
83 jquery  ajax  safari 


3
Controlador de errores global Ajax con AngularJS
Cuando mi sitio web era 100% jQuery, solía hacer esto: $.ajaxSetup({ global: true, error: function(xhr, status, err) { if (xhr.status == 401) { window.location = "./index.html"; } } }); para configurar un controlador global para errores 401. Ahora, uso angularjs con $resourcey $httppara hacer mis solicitudes (REST) ​​al servidor. ¿Hay …

2
Representación asíncrona de componentes de Reactjs
Quiero renderizar mi componente después de que finalice mi solicitud ajax. Abajo puedes ver mi código var CategoriesSetup = React.createClass({ render: function(){ var rows = []; $.get('http://foobar.io/api/v1/listings/categories/').done(function (data) { $.each(data, function(index, element){ rows.push(<OptionRow obj={element} />); }); return (<Input type='select'>{rows}</Input>) }) } }); Pero recibo el error a continuación porque estoy …

5
Jquery y HTML FormData devuelve "Error de tipo no detectado: invocación ilegal"
Estoy usando este script para cargar mis archivos de imagen: http://jsfiddle.net/eHmSr/ $('.uploader input:file').on('change', function() { $this = $(this); $('.alert').remove(); $.each($this[0].files, function(key, file) { $('.files').append('<li>' + file.name + '</li>'); data = new FormData(); data.append(file.name, file); $.ajax({ url: $('.uploader').attr('action'), type: 'POST', dataType: 'json', data: data }); }); }); Pero cuando hago clic …
82 jquery  ajax  html  upload 


Al usar nuestro sitio, usted reconoce que ha leído y comprende nuestra Política de Cookies y Política de Privacidad.
Licensed under cc by-sa 3.0 with attribution required.